Upload a photo, get 5 AI-generated captions, and overlay them directly onto your image with professional fonts and styling. The only caption tool where the text goes on your photo — not just in a text box.






Most caption generators give you text in a box. Ours is different — the AI analyzes your image, generates captions, and overlays them directly onto your photo with professional fonts and styling. One tool, finished result.
AI generates & overlays on your photo
Pick one → It's on your image
From photo upload to captioned image — the entire process takes under 30 seconds
Upload your photo to the editor. The clearer the subject, the better the AI suggestions.
The AI scans your image and generates 5 creative caption options tailored to the content.
Select a caption — it's automatically overlaid on your image. Customize fonts, colors, and effects, then download.
Generate AI captions and overlay them on your photos — ready to post, no extra apps needed
AI generates scroll-stopping captions and overlays them on your photo. Download a ready-to-post image with text already styled.
Get punchy on-screen text overlaid on thumbnails. The AI creates attention-grabbing captions sized for short-form video.
Generate promotional text and overlay it on product photos. Ideal for Shopify, Etsy, and marketplace listings.
AI writes ad copy and overlays it on your creative. High-impact text for Facebook Ads, Google Ads, and display banners.
Generate captions and overlay them as text on blog images. Create engaging featured images with text already baked in.
Turn any photo into an inspirational quote graphic. The AI matches the mood and overlays beautiful text directly on the image.
Other caption generators give you plain text. Ours generates captions and overlays them directly on your photo with professional styling.
Unlike ChatGPT where you describe the image, our AI analyzes the actual visual content — objects, people, scenery, lighting, and mood — for more accurate, relevant captions.
The caption is added directly onto your photo with 100+ fonts, text effects, and professional styling. Download a finished image — not just a line of text.
Get 5 different caption styles in every generation — from witty and casual to professional and inspirational. Pick the tone that matches your brand.
Upload → Analyze → 5 captions overlaid on your image. The entire process takes less than 5 seconds.
Real examples of captions our AI generates from different types of photos.
Sunset Beach Photo
Coffee & Workspace Photo
City Architecture Photo
Most caption tools give you text. We give you a finished image.
Generate platform-optimized captions overlaid on your photos
Posts, Reels, Stories
TikTok
Covers & Thumbnails
YouTube
Thumbnails & Community
Posts & Ads
Pins & Idea Pins
X / Twitter
Tweets & Threads
Upload a photo and our AI analyzes its content — identifying objects, people, scenery, mood, colors, and context. In under 5 seconds, it generates 5 unique captions and overlays them directly onto your image. Pick your favorite, customize the font, color, and position, and download the finished captioned image.
The AI Caption Generator is a Pro feature included with our Pro plan. You can explore the editor for free, but generating AI captions requires a Pro subscription. Pro also unlocks 4K exports, unlimited saved designs, and all premium text effects.
Absolutely! The generated captions work perfectly for Instagram posts, Reels, TikTok videos, YouTube thumbnails, Twitter/X posts, Pinterest pins, and any social media platform. You can also use them for marketing materials, ads, and website content.
Yes! The AI provides creative starting points, but you have full control. Edit the text, change fonts (100+ options), adjust colors, add shadows, outlines, and even apply special effects like 'Text Behind Image' or 'Knockout Text' to make your caption stand out.
The AI works with any image — portraits, selfies, landscapes, food photos, product shots, travel pics, pets, fitness content, and more. Photos with clear subjects and good lighting produce the best results. Even abstract or artistic images get creative caption suggestions.
Unlike ChatGPT, our AI image caption generator actually 'sees' your image. It analyzes the visual content — not just text you describe. This means captions are specifically tailored to what's IN your photo, making them more relevant and authentic. Plus, you can instantly add the caption to your image with professional styling.
Currently, the AI generates captions primarily in English. However, you can edit the generated text and translate it to any language, or provide a prompt in your preferred language to guide the AI's suggestions.
Not at all! The tool is designed for everyone — from social media beginners to professional marketers. Upload your photo, click 'AI Magic Text', choose a caption, and you're done. No Photoshop or design experience needed.
Upload your photo to the editor, then click 'AI Magic Text'. The AI analyzes the image and generates 5 creative captions in seconds. When you pick one, it's automatically overlaid onto your image as styled text — customize the font, color, and position, then download the finished image.
AI caption generation saves significant time and helps overcome writer's block. Our tool analyzes visual elements humans might overlook, and generates multiple options in seconds. You can always edit the AI suggestions to add your personal voice — it's a starting point, not a replacement for your creativity.
Overlay Text's image caption generator is built specifically for social media creators. Unlike generic AI tools that just output text, it analyzes your actual photo, generates platform-optimized captions, and overlays the text directly onto your image with professional fonts and effects — all in one tool. You download a finished captioned image, not just a line of text.
Yes! Our photo caption generator is used by businesses for product photography, social media marketing, e-commerce listings, and ad creatives. The AI suggests professional, engaging captions that match your brand's tone. Generate captions for product shots, team photos, event coverage, and more.
Currently, you generate captions one image at a time — upload a photo, get 5 captions, pick and download. This ensures the AI gives each photo focused, high-quality analysis rather than generic bulk text. For teams processing many images, each generation takes under 5 seconds so you can move through a batch quickly.
Each generation produces 5 captions across different tones: witty/funny, professional/polished, casual/conversational, inspirational/motivational, and descriptive/storytelling. This gives you a range to choose from depending on your brand voice and the platform you're posting to.
Upload a photo, get AI-generated captions, and download a finished image with text overlaid — all in under 30 seconds.
Upload Image →